Comments:

Was good. Was quite humbled when what appeared to be a 12 year old girl passed me as we were turning off State Street. Man, NEVER will I EVER allow that to happen again. *shakes head* Legs felt good first mile and a half...then I started to feel the acid fill the legs. HR was stuck at 192 and it seemed it was around 6:40-7:20 min/mile. If I tried to accelerate, my HR would drop as many as it went up...(i.e. 194 would drop me to 190..then back to 192) I could only sustain an elevated HR for about 20 seconds. I had a kick at the end...about 60m worth. Not too bad.
What would you do differently?:

Train more. A lot more.
Post race
Warm down:

'Ice' (cold water) bath, walked a mile, Nana stretched me

What limited your ability to perform faster:

Lack of training. I've been seriously training since May 3rd. I'll run 2-3 times a week. I'm trying to build a base for a longer Tri next year. I went out thinking I could run like I did in college...but it takes time to build up fitness. I just need to be consistent with training and put the aerobic miles in.
